I know we’re all terrified by America right now, but you need to know what is happening in Britain, there’s so much shit going on, but here’s some of the highlights:
The UN have condemned the British government for “grave” failures regarding disabled people’s rights. [x]
There are over half a million people using food banks, because they cannot afford to eat. [x]
The benefits system is declaring people fit to work, ignoring the opinions of their doctors, and refusing them money unless they spend 35 hours a week actively looking for work. These include people with severe disabilities, mental health issues, and people who are literally dying. In fact, around eighty people a month die within six weeks of being declared fit to work by this system. [x]
16.7% of the population is living in poverty, with a further 30% at serious risk of slipping into poverty [x]
Children are suffering from such severe malnutrition they’re having to be treated for rickets. [x]
It’s currently estimated that 1 in 200 people in the UK are homeless. [x]
This is just a tiny snapshot, and I won’t even go into the NHS crisis, because that deserves it’s own massive post.

since it’s Audrey Hepburn’s birthday here are some cool facts about what a badass women she was
(1) during world war two Audrey worked for the resistance and did what she could to fight against the nazi in holland even though her parents were supporters of the nazi party going against her parents anti Semitic and racist beliefs she fought for justice
(2) after her retirement from acting she became a UNICEF Ambassador Audrey lived in occupied holland during world war two so she knew what it was like to grow up hungry so in her later years she worked tirelessly to make sure children in warn torn countries had the aid they needed
(3) ” I can testify to what UNICEF means to children, because I was among those who received food and medical relief right after World War II, I have a long-lasting gratitude and trust for what UNICEF does.” Audrey Hepburn was so much more then just a style icon and an actress.
(4) “There’s a moral obligation that those who have should give to those who don’t.” Audrey Hepburn my love you are deeply missed
